Overview
Application.
β-galactosidase is used for reverse phase (RP) adsorption. It is also used for the hydrolysis of whey lactose.
Biochemical / physiological behavior.
β-galactosidase breaks down lactose into its monosaccharide components, glucose and galactose. It also catalyzes the conversion of glucose to isolactose, an inducer of β-galactosidase, in the feedback loop.
Unit definition.
At 30 ℃, one unit hydrolyzes 1 millimoles of lactose per minute when pH is 4.5.
